The Sterling Music Exchange is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ization which provides opportunities for young adult musicians to perform.  We believe music improves self-esteem, self-confidence and self-expression.

Step Up to Music

In a little over 1 year, SME has provided
 free lessons and instruments to 32 young adults
through the Step Up to Music program.

Our students have come from Fitchburg, Leominster, Sterling,
Lunenburg, Worcester, Marlboro, Westminster & Clinton

Our goal is to provide the gift of music-making
to 100 young adults in 3 years.
